Hiking and Skiing vs OnTheSnow Ski & Snow Report
OnTheSnow Ski & Snow Report is the better choice for dedicated ski and snow reports due to its focused features and generally positive user experience, despite some accuracy and stability issues, while Hiking and Skiing offers more diverse outdoor features but struggles with usability and subscription value.
Hiking and Skiing excels at AR peak identification and general outdoor navigation but is hampered by a complex interface, frequent bugs, and a controversial subscription model. OnTheSnow Ski & Snow Report is a dedicated ski app, praised for its comprehensive snow reports and ease of use, though it faces criticism for data inaccuracy and occasional instability.
